Willkommen, Gast ( Anmelden | Registrierung )     [ Hilfe | Mitglieder | Suche ]

 
Reply to this topicStart new topic
> Kontaktformular: Mailversand funktioniert nicht
wabue
Beitrag Tue. 28. October 2014, 10:30
Beitrag #1


Member
**

Gruppe: Members
Beiträge: 28
Mitglied seit: 10.04.2008
Mitglieds-Nr.: 1.463



Hallo zusammen

Nach einem Serverumzug bei Hosteurope funktioniert bei mehreren Websites der Mailversand im Kontaktformular nicht mehr (Sefrengo 1.6.0 / Kontaktformular 2.2.). Der Versand des Formulars wird zwar bestätigt, ein Mail kommt allerdings nicht an. PHP-Info
Wo könnte der Hund begraben sein?

Danke für eure Hilfe
Wabü
Go to the top of the page
 
+Quote Post
FireFlyer
Beitrag Tue. 28. October 2014, 21:18
Beitrag #2


Advanced Member
*******

Gruppe: AdvancedMembers
Beiträge: 446
Mitglied seit: 12.09.2006
Wohnort: Bamberg
Mitglieds-Nr.: 235



Schau mal Im KIS nach, ob du eine Standard-Mailadresse hinterlegt hast.
Webhosting => Skripte => Standard-E-Mail-Adresse
Go to the top of the page
 
+Quote Post
wabue
Beitrag Wed. 29. October 2014, 09:51
Beitrag #3


Member
**

Gruppe: Members
Beiträge: 28
Mitglied seit: 10.04.2008
Mitglieds-Nr.: 1.463



Danke für den Tipp. Das habe ich nun eingerichtet, bringt aber keine Veränderung.
Go to the top of the page
 
+Quote Post
FireFlyer
Beitrag Wed. 29. October 2014, 18:27
Beitrag #4


Advanced Member
*******

Gruppe: AdvancedMembers
Beiträge: 446
Mitglied seit: 12.09.2006
Wohnort: Bamberg
Mitglieds-Nr.: 235



Irgendwas in den Error-Logs gefunden?
Go to the top of the page
 
+Quote Post
Skylab
Beitrag Wed. 29. October 2014, 18:36
Beitrag #5


Advanced Member
*****

Gruppe: Neustart-Moderator
Beiträge: 176
Mitglied seit: 03.02.2007
Mitglieds-Nr.: 625



Wenn Du SF 1.6 verwendest solltest Du PHP 5.4 oder 5.5 mal aufschalten, gut möglich, dass es dann läuft.

Grüße, Sky
Go to the top of the page
 
+Quote Post
topi009
Beitrag Tue. 25. November 2014, 15:46
Beitrag #6


Newbie
*

Gruppe: Members
Beiträge: 7
Mitglied seit: 07.10.2013
Mitglieds-Nr.: 2.515



Hallo,

ich habe das selbe Problem. Nur bei mir ist es bereits eine bestehende Webseite wo von jetzt auf gleich das Kontaktformular nicht mehr geht.
Hat jemand noch eine Lösung?

S 01.04.05 / K 2.2
php 5.3.2
Go to the top of the page
 
+Quote Post
sidd
Beitrag Sun. 30. November 2014, 16:38
Beitrag #7


Sefrengo Reloaded
***

Gruppe: Members
Beiträge: 62
Mitglied seit: 14.06.2012
Wohnort: Gransee
Mitglieds-Nr.: 2.487



schau mal, ob der mailversand auch mit einem häckchen im modul aktiviert ist.

wenn ja, probiere folgendes:

erstelle eine neue php datei im document_root deiner domain und nenne sie test.php

dort schreibst du folgendes rein:
QUELLTEXT
<?php
if(mail("deine@mailadresse","testmail","das ist eine testmail")){
echo "mail verschickt";
}else{
echo "fehler beim mailversand";
};
?>


dann rufe http://www.deinedomain.de/test.php in deinem browser auf.
wenn die mail verschickt wurde, sollte "mail verschickt" ausgegeben werden.
schaue ob an deine mail die testmail zugestellt wurde.

sollte die mail verschickt worden sein und trotzdem nicht in deinem postfach sein, könnte es evtl. bei einem shared-hoster sein, das der entsprechende server auf einer blacklist steht.

checken kannst du das hier:http://mxtoolbox.com/SuperTool.aspx?action...p;run=toolpage#

viel erfolg!

Der Beitrag wurde von sidd bearbeitet: Sun. 30. November 2014, 16:40


--------------------
Sefrengo | Das CMS passend für viele Gelegenheiten ;)
Go to the top of the page
 
+Quote Post
topi009
Beitrag Fri. 5. December 2014, 10:47
Beitrag #8


Newbie
*

Gruppe: Members
Beiträge: 7
Mitglied seit: 07.10.2013
Mitglieds-Nr.: 2.515



Es hat funktioniert. E-mail ist angekommen.

Kontakformular geht aber noch immer nicht. sad.gif

Soll ich das Modul nochmal komplett neu installieren?

Was kann ich noch tun?
Go to the top of the page
 
+Quote Post
sidd
Beitrag Tue. 9. December 2014, 11:46
Beitrag #9


Sefrengo Reloaded
***

Gruppe: Members
Beiträge: 62
Mitglied seit: 14.06.2012
Wohnort: Gransee
Mitglieds-Nr.: 2.487



gehe mal in den modulcode und suche folgendes:
QUELLTEXT
$result = $mail->process();//$mail->send(array($to), 'mail');


ersetze es mit:
QUELLTEXT
$result = $mail->process();//$mail->send(array($to), 'mail');
mail($to,$subject,$tpl_email,"From:".$sender);


ist nur ein hotfix wink.gif


--------------------
Sefrengo | Das CMS passend für viele Gelegenheiten ;)
Go to the top of the page
 
+Quote Post

Reply to this topicStart new topic
1 Besucher lesen dieses Thema (Gäste: 1 | Anonyme Besucher: 0)
0 Mitglieder:

 



RSS Vereinfachte Darstellung Aktuelles Datum: 28.3.24 - 23:34

Sefrengo ist ein eingetragenes Markenzeichen und urheberrechtlich geschützt.
Copyright 2009 Design & Daten, Alle Rechte vorbehalten.